Understanding the Basics of Online Forms

Before diving into the nuances of online forms, it’s vital for your team to grasp what these forms are and how they function. Online forms are digital versions of traditional paper forms. They allow users to input data which can then be collected and analyzed. Familiarizing your team with various types of online forms—such as surveys, registration forms, and feedback forms—sets the stage for effective training.

Encouraging Feedback and Continuous Improvement

Training shouldn’t be a one-time event. Encourage your team to seek feedback from users who interact with the forms. This can provide insights into potential improvements. Regularly reviewing forms and their performance can help identify areas that need enhancement. Establish a routine where your team can discuss feedback and implement changes accordingly. This practice fosters a culture of continuous improvement.

Leveraging Integration with Other Tools

Many online form platforms offer integration with other software tools, such as CRM systems, email marketing platforms, and project management tools. Training your team on how to use these integrations can enhance workflow efficiency. For instance, integrating forms with your CRM can automate data entry, saving time and reducing errors. Encourage your team to explore these integrations to optimize their processes.

Measuring Success and Setting Goals

To ensure that your training is effective, establish clear metrics for success. These could include completion rates, user satisfaction scores, or the speed of data processing. Setting specific goals helps your team understand what they need to achieve. Regularly review these metrics and adjust your training as necessary. This proactive approach keeps your team aligned with the organization’s objectives.
